How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hunter?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hunter Studio Apartments | $1,125 | $750 | $1,500 |
Hunter 1 Bedroom Apartments | $781 | $550 | $1,100 |
| Hunter 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,010 | $450 | $1,475 |
| Hunter 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,211 | $929 | $1,746 |
| Hunter 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,442 | $1,442 | $1,442 |

Largest Available Hunter and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
The largest available 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Hunter, KS is found at The Bluffs (KS) and is 793 square feet priced from $825. South Park Apartments in the Harvey County neighborhood has the second largest 1 Bedroom, which is sized at 681 square feet and currently listed start at $920. Here is today’s list of the largest available 1 Bedroom units in Hunter: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Square Footage |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Bluffs (KS) | One Bedroom Large | 793 Sq Ft | $825 |
| South Park Apartments | 1 BED 1 BATH | 681 Sq Ft | $920 |
| Burlington Place | 1 Bed 1 Bath | 666 Sq Ft | $675 |
| Indian Guide Terrace | 1 BR | 588 Sq Ft | $250 |
| Skyview Apartments | 1b 1b | 500 Sq Ft | $625 |
Cheapest Available Hunter and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
As of July 16, 2026 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Hunter, KS is the 1 BR Model starting from $250 at Indian Guide Terrace . The second most affordable Hunter 1 Bedroom is the 1b 1b Model at Skyview Apartments starting at $625 in the Harvey County neighborhood.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Hunter is currently $781.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in Hunter: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
|---|---|---|
| Indian Guide Terrace | 1 BR | $250 |
| Skyview Apartments | 1b 1b | $625 |
| Burlington Place | 1 Bed 1 Bath | $675 |
| The Bluffs (KS) | One Bedroom Large | $825 |
| South Park Apartments | 1 BED 1 BATH | $920 |
